Standing on the Plateau de Bages, the vineyard of Château Croizet-Bages, a Pauillac 5th Grand Cru Classé, grows peacefully and harmoniously. It is said that just beyond this ocean of vines planted on this majestic terroir which seems to have been made for contemplation and prayer, a charterhouse used to stand.

The original owners of the estate were the Croizet brothers in the first half of the 18th century, and today the château is run by another pair of siblings, Jean-Philippe and Anne-Françoise Quié.

With the typical ambition of today’s generation and a keen sense of detail both in the vineyard and in the winery, Jean-Philippe and Anne-Françoise expertly craft their La Chartreuse de Croizet-Bages as one worthy of its elder. This expert pair of winemakers have produced a simply majestic wine.

Generous, fruity and charming, the 2010 vintage of "La Chartreuse de Croizet-Bages" perfectly embodies the gourmet style of the great Pauillac wines. Its deep colour, backed up by notes of violet and blackberry, suggests a moment of intense sensuality. Its prestigious terroir lends it refinement and balance. Harmonious, its length on the palate gives it a remarkable freshness, a symbol of pleasure and longevity.

LA CHARTREUSE DE CROIZET-BAGESPAUILLAC

VINTAGE 2010

Vineyard Vineyard area: 30 ha. Location: Bages (Pauillac) Soil: Garonne gravels Average age of the vines: 35 years Density: 9,000 vines per hectare

Harvest: Manual harvesting with sorting table

Blend: 50% Cabernet Sauvignon, 38% Merlot, 12% Cabernet Franc.

Ageing: 12 months in French oak barrels
